Ross Taylor VP, SW Engineering

Ross Taylor has worked at Quanergy since January 2014. He oversees all algorithm and software development toward Quanergy’s product roadmap. Mr. Taylor has been developing LiDAR and robotics systems and software for more than 20 years. Prior to joining Quanergy, he worked primarily on NASA and DoD LiDAR programs including 3D inspection of the Space Shuttle, planetary rover navigation, and roadside change detection. In addition, he worked on robotics control problems including NASA’s Robonaut. Mr. Taylor received his Master of Science degree in mechanical engineering from The University of Texas and his Bachelor of Science degree in mechanical engineering from Louisiana Tech University.

Alfy Riddle VP, HW Engineering

Alfred Riddle, Ph.D. has worked at Quanergy since September of 2018. He developed the M8-PoE, MQ, and was responsible for the release of the S3-2 NSO and WSO products. Prior to Quanergy Dr. Riddle worked on full-duplex networking at Kumu Networks and prior to that analog high speed semiconductor circuit design including 50GHz amplifiers and 20 GHz mixers at MACOM Technologies. Dr. Riddle has had a wide range of product, integrated circuit and software company experiences as well as teaching at Santa Clara University.
